  • The 2032 United States Presidential Election was the 62nd quadrennial presidential election, held on Tuesday, November 8, 2032. The election took place among the backdrop of the Labor Crisis that had ruined the promises of incumbent President and Republican candidate Maya Garcia to bring about a new era of prosperity. The Progressive nomination went to the well-known governor of the most populous state, California's Dylan J. Price, who had been reelected governor in a landslide in 2030. Price marshaled his party and brought in a leading Rust Belt liberal as his running mate, Senator Sam Allan of Michigan. Price repeatedly blamed Garcia for the Depression and worsening economy. With employment above 120% in 2032 alone, Garcia was remiss to defend her record, and Price promised recovery with a series of radical immigration reforms and new social services to ease the burden of elderly care in the country. Price won by 36% of voter's first choices, and well over 66% of voter's second choices, receiving the highest percentage of the popular vote for a Progressive nominee. On election night, upon hearing of their victory, the 81 year old Sam Alan suffered a massive stroke and died just as he and Price had won. To ease national tensions and seal his coalition, Price nominated Labor Party rival Ivory Toldson to replace Alan as VP. The election marked the effective end of the Sixth Party System, dominated by Republicans. Subsequent landslides in the 2034 mid-term elections and following presidential election two and four years later respectively, signified the commencement of the Seventh Party System, dominated by Price's Progressive Coalition.
